Recommended Flat Towing Set Up for a 2022 Subaru Crosstrek w/ Manual Transmission

Question:
What is needed to flat tow a 2022 Subaru Crosstrek?Would prefer Blue ox but am open to suggestions.
asked by: Cal
Expert Reply:
To flat tow a 2022 Subaru Crosstrek you will need a base plate kit, wiring harness, supplemental braking system, brake light kit, and a charge line kit to keep your battery from dying on the way to your destination. Without modification you will only be able to flat tow a Crosstrek if it has a manual transmission.
The Blue Ox Base Plate Kit item # BX3622 is confirmed to fit your Crosstrek and is compatible with many tow bars including the etrailer SD Non-Binding Tow Bar item # e47ZR you were looking at. This base plate has easily removable arms that offer a seamless look when you're not flat towing.
For lighting we have the Roadmaster item # RM-15247. The diode kit that comes with this allows you to splice into the taillight wiring so that your RV controls the vehicle taillights and does not require drilling into the taillight housings. This comes with a round 6-way connector that you will install on the front of your towed vehicle and enough coiled wire to reach the RV.
Since you have a brand new vehicle, I recommend the Demco SBS Stay-IN-Play DUO Supplemental Braking System item # SM99251. This is a proportional system that activates the brakes in your Crosstrek with the same amount of pressure that you apply with your motorhome. The SMI Stay-IN-Play will function automatically when your Crosstrek is hooked up, so after you install it once you will never need to remove or activate it. I recommend adding the Roadmaster Brake-Lite Relay Kit item # RM-88400 which keeps your Subaru's brake signal from overriding the turn signal sent by your motorhome.
Last but not least you will want the Roadmaster Battery Charge Line Kit for Towed Vehicles item # RM-156-25. This kit will ensure that you do not have a dead battery when you arrive at your destination.
You will most likely also need a high low adapter so that the tow bar will be level when you are flat towing. I have attached a link to a page that has all of the ones we carry and a how to article about selecting the right one.
